Renault Chairman Jean Dominique Senard would soon step down from Nissan's board of directors, some people related to this matter claimed, underscoring the ongoing leadership shakeup at the Japanese automaker after the unsuccessful attempt to merge with Honda.
According to industry insights, another Renault representative, Pierre Fleuriot, will also resign from the position on Nissan's board, and the French automaker will appoint a replacement for both vacant positions. Spokespeople for Nissan and Renault did not comment on this matter.
The new appointees of Renault will participate in key decision-making as new CEO Ivan Espinosa aims to settle Nissan's finances and secure partnerships that will stabilize the company's global performance.
The sources claimed that Honda and Nissan closed their merger talks in February as both directors had opposed Nissan's idea to merge with Honda.
Senard stated in March that the failed deal was not only extremely rapid, also a little brutal and not in the interest of Renault. The French automaker has the largest shareholding in Nissan even after gradually losing a decades-long alliance.
Nissan has been seeking to revive its global footprint and cater to sales in the US and China. The automaker also announced the significant job cuts and production before its record debt bill is due next year. Earlier this month, Espinosa replaced Makoto Uchida as CEO as part of a broader reshuffle in the board of directors team that also includes the appointment of new technology and production chiefs.
